Anyway my question is if a Pokemon has Flash Fire and Baton Pass (Like Rapidash) and it switches in on a Fire move to get that Firepower boost then uses Agility and Passes it to something. Does it then also pass that Firepower boost if I pass to a non fire Pokemon but throw on a common off-type available Fire move like Fire Punch or something? Baton Pass states it passes all stat boosts and some other effects but Flash Fire states it boosts all Fire MOVES and not the Attack stat when using a Fire move.
No it is not Baton Passed. Taunt does not lock your opponent into executing the same move. It simply disallows the selection of a non-attacking move. I believe you're thinking of a combination of encore and taunt.Say I lead with a Taunter that outspeeds a TrickScarfer. If I pull off the Taunt while they attempt to Trick (i.e., "The foe's X can no longer use Trick due to the Taunt!"), are they now stuck with Trick and must either Struggle or switch, or are they free to choose another move?

My question is: I sit possible to EV a level 100 Pokemon using the Box Trick? I have heard yes and no.......
No, Lv. 100 Pokemon don't gain EVs because they don't gain experience. Because of that, there will never be a way to EV train Lv. 100 Pokemon, unless Gamefreak allows it in Gen 5.
